Job Description

Ensure proper training and supervision of all personnel, to deliver prompt, courteous service in a manner that complies with Omni Food and Beverage standards and company policies and procedures. Salary of $68,000 + based on experience



Responsibilities

    Responsible for the supervision and coordination of assigned shift, assisting in overall management.
  • Complete environmental checklist for dining room. Supervise related associate assignments.
  • Stay on the floor during peak hours, supervising the performance of associates.
  • Monitor each guest experience.
  • Examine food and beverage preparation and provide corrective training where necessary.
  • Supervise bar controls, shot glass use, red lining, bottles totally empty, liquor par list.
  • Supervise cost control efforts to ensure the operations financial success.
  • Participate in scheduling within budgetary guidelines.
  • Forecast weekly and monthly.
  • Completing weekly payroll and associated audit.
  • Monitor labor and payroll costs.
  • Oversee the order of daily supplies.
  • Supervise the maintenance of dining room for cleanliness, sanitation, and appearance.
  • Prepare maintenance requests, follow up.
  • Hold pre-meal meetings with associates.
  • Follow up on established training steps, supervise performance, and provide necessary re-training.
  • Participate in interviewing new associates.
  • Must be familiar with and adhere to all liquor liability laws.
  • Must know emergency procedures (including CPR) and work to prevent accidents.
  • Handle guest comments and complaints.
  • Responsible for reporting all product/service defects, and measuring process attributes as applicable.


Qualifications

  • At least 1 year Food & Beverage/Restaurant experience.
  • Previous hospitality/hotel experience strongly preferred.
  • Strong bar knowledge required.
  • Bachelor degree or equivalent
  • Must be a team player.
  • Must have a great attitude along with excellent guest service skills.
  • Must be able to work a flexible schedule including mornings, nights, weekends, and holidays.
